Milk Jug / Pop-Up Masks

This is my milk jug mask.   I made it by cutting a milk carton and covering it with masking tape.  I then added color using vinyl and heat transfer scraps and texture using some beads I had laying around and some twigs from my flower bed.  I love the way it turned out!


We were asked to make a second mask using the technique of our choice and this is what I came up with:
This guy was made using a pattern that I found here.  I added some leftover edible Easter grass for the green hair and I used oil pastels to add the details of his eyes and curly-stache!  I think he turned out pretty cool!  I LOVE making something 2 dimensional come to life!
